People of the Phil. vs. Pedro Delima, Jr

PEOPLE OF THE PHILIPPINES, Appellee, versus PEDRO DELIMA, JR., Appeellant.

G.R. No. 169869 | 2007-07-12

D E C I S I O N
 


AUSTRIA-MARTINEZ, J.:

For automatic review is the Decision[1] of the Court of Appeals (CA) dated August 16, 2005 in CA-G.R. CR-H.C. No. 00464, affirming the conviction of accused Pedro Delima, Jr. (appellant) of the crime of Parricide, imposing upon him the penalty of death, and ordering him to pay P50,000.00 as civil indemnity, P50,000.00 as moral damages, and P15,000.00 as temperate damages.
